Spokane Gymnastics history

Spokane Elite Gymnastics was in business for over 30 years, with multiple owners in several different Valley locations. In August 1999, Seattle Gymnastics Academy, Inc. bought Spokane Elite Gymnastics. In June 2007, Nadine Burgess was promoted to manage Spokane Elite Gymnastics. The small but mighty crew transformed Spokane Elite Gymnastics to provide quality preschool, instructional and competitive programs. 

Growth continued until the Spring of 2010 when the owner of Seattle Gymnastics Academy opted to focus on his four gyms in Seattle. He provided the opportunity for the staff at Spokane Elite Gymnastics to buy the business. Nadine Burgess, the current owner, started a new corporation and changed the name to “Spokane Gymnastics” in conjunction with the new ownership effective July 1, 2010, which better reflects the mission of Spokane Gymnastics, to provide an exceptional gymnastics experience for students with all levels and goals.

In September of 2013, Nadine purchased the 30,000 square foot facility only a couple of miles east of the former leased Broadway location. All programs moved to the main facility, now known as “Spokane Gymnastics Argonne Village,” in 2014.

OUR FACILITY


Our facility is located near Argonne and Montgomery, just east of the Yokes Fresh Market. We feature all Olympic events (spring floor, high bar, parallel bars, uneven bars, vault, rings, pommel horse and beams), plus 40′ long tumbl trak, rod floor, inflatable jumping castle, and air bag “pit” with zip-line!

Our entire 30,000 s.f. facility is air conditioned. We have viewing areas for parents and siblings to be able to watch all rotations, plus a walking track upstairs in the main gym, toddler area, plus large lobby. USA GYMNASTICS MEMBER CLUB

USA Gymnastics (USAG) is the sole national governing body for the sport of gymnastics in the United States. This designation comes from the U.S. Olympic Committee, and the International Gymnastics Federation (FIG). USAG sets the rules and policies that govern gymnastics in the United States.  Spokane Gymnastics is a USAG Member Club.  Many of our coaches are Professional Members as well as USAG Safety Certified.  Spokane Gymnastics instructors have earned numerous additional USAG certifications through Regional Congresses and training throughout the Northwest.
